Nomura head of rates sales Anderson to exit in latest London shake-up

Robbie Anderson to leave Japanese bank after almost five years

Nomura’s Emea head of flow rates sales is departing after almost five years, in the latest shake-up at the Japanese bank’s London office.

Robbie Anderson, who spent 18 years in rates sales at RBS before joining Nomura in 2018, has decided to leave the bank, according to an internal memo seen by Financial News.
